Accountant / Bookkeeper (Part-time) - Real Estate. Our Client is a family owned private property investment and development company. The company currently manages a property portfolio with significant potential for further growth within the M4 corridor and Thames Valley. The portfolio consists of commercial, industrial and some residential properties.

The Role gives a great opportunity for an able Accountant/Bookkeeper to work within a small and dynamic team. The candidate will have total responsibility of the finance function and report directly to the Managing Director. The main responsibilities of the role will include:

  • Producing quarterly management accounts.
  • Providing all supporting commentary for the group.
  • Preparing supporting schedules for year-end statutory accounts.
  • Preparing service charge accounts and performing the reconciliations.
  • Preparing VAT returns and filing with HMRC.
  • Managing the credit control function.
  • Budgeting and forecasting.
  • Preparing development project financial appraisals and progress reporting.
  • Processing all bank payments and receipts.
  • Reviewing all purchase invoices for approval by Managing Director.
  • Overseeing the payroll and processing staff expense claims.
  • Managing the workplace pension
  • Preparing quarterly management charges.
  • Preparing of annual accounts for Charity Trust.

The Person will be ACA, ACCA, CIMA qualified or qualified by experience ideally with prior experience of working within the real estate sector (but not essential), be self-motivated and comfortable working in a small but growing business. The applicant will be the main person overseeing the full finance function and therefore should be a hands-on accountant- the person should be able to communicate effectively and deal with high-level strategic accounting as well as day to day bookkeeping. Candidates must have experience working with property accounting systems such as Propman, QUBE, Tramps or similar and a confident Excel user.
